Historical Roots: From Brick-and-Mortar to Digital Slots

The allure of Egyptian motifs in gaming can be traced back to early physical slot machines of the 20th century. These mechanical devices often featured hieroglyphs, pyramids, and scarabs, serving as visual cues that appealed to curiosity and adventure-seeking players. As technology advanced, particularly with the advent of online casinos in the late 1990s and early 2000s, developers began to incorporate these themes into digital formats, leveraging the flexibility of virtual design and animation.

The Rise of Themed Slots and the Role of Cultural Significance

Modern slot games such as Book of Ra and its successors popularised the Egyptian theme globally. These titles combine immersive storytelling with high-quality graphics and bonus mechanics rooted in the mythos of gods like Osiris and Anubis. Industry analysts note that integrating historical and mythological elements enhances player engagement, as it adds layers of narrative depth beyond mere chance-based gambling. Such games often feature symbols like ankhs, pyramids, and pharaohs, which evoke the grandeur and spiritual significance of ancient Egypt.

Emerging Trends: Authenticity and Cultural Sensitivity

As the industry matures, developers face the challenge of balancing authenticity with entertainment. Recent explorations into Egyptian-themed slots aim to deliver accurate representations of historical symbols and narratives, supported by research and consultation with Egyptologists. This effort aligns with a broader industry trend towards responsible gaming and cultural sensitivity, ensuring that themes do not perpetuate stereotypes or inaccuracies.

Technological Innovations and Interactive Features

Feature Description Impact on Player Engagement
Randomly Triggered Bonus Spins Mechanics that activate bonus rounds based on specific symbols or events, often tied to mythological stories. Enhances anticipation and replay value.
Interactive Mini-Games Embedded games where players can explore temples or decipher hieroglyphs. Increases immersion and educational appeal.
3D and AR Visualisation Use of augmented reality to bring ancient artefacts to life within a mobile environment. Creates novel, memorable gaming experiences.
